It is most fitting that the Year For Priests, inaugurated by His Holiness, Pope Benedict XVI, begins on the Solemnity of the Heart of Jesus. In his book The Priest in Union with Christ, Dominican priest Fr. Reginald Garrigou-LaGrange explicitly connects the holiness of the priest to devotion to the Sacred Heart of Jesus. There he encourages devotion to the Eucharistic Heart of Jesus-that heart that gave us and continues to give us the gift of the Eucharist-as an “effective means of attaining priestly perfection.” Accordingly, he recommends the Prayer to the Eucharistic Heart of Jesus not only for priests, but for all who wish to grow closer to Christ in the Eucharist:
PRAYER TO THE EUCHARISTIC HEART OF JESUS
Eucharistic Heart of Jesus, gracious companion of our exile, I adore Thee.
Eucharistic Heart of Jesus,
lonely Heart,
humiliated Heart,
abandoned Heart,
forgotten Heart,
despised Heart,
outraged Heart,
Heart ignored by men,
Heart which loves our own hearts;
Heart pleading for our love,
Heart so patient in waiting for us,
Heart so eager to listen to our prayers,
Heart so anxious for our requests,
Heart, unending source of new graces,
Heart so silent, yet desiring to speak to souls,
Heart, welcome refuge of the hidden life,
Heart, teacher of the secrets of union with God,
Heart of Him Who sleeps but watches always,
Eucharistic Heart of Jesus, have mercy on us.Jesus Victim, I desire to comfort Thee;
I unite myself to Thee;
I offer myself in union with Thee.I regard myself as nothing in Thy Presence. I long to forget myself in order to think only of Thee, to be despised and forgotten for love of Thee. I have no desire to be understood or loved by anyone but Thee. I will keep silent in order to listen to Thee, and I will abandon myself in order to lose myself in Thee.
Grant that I may thus satisfy Thy thirst for my salvation, Thy burning thirst for my holiness,
and that once purified I may give Thee a sincere and pure love. I am anxious not to tire Thee
further with waiting: take me, I hand myself over to Thee. I give Thee all my actions, my mind to be enlightened, my heart to be directed, my will to be stabilized, my wretchedness to be relieved, my soul and body to be nourished by Thee.Eucharistic Heart of my Saviour, Whose Blood is the life of my soul, may I myself cease to live
and Thou alone live in me. Amen.
